Transaction 3e63caab1943a32747f9701ba5281f707658c693bf0e9b6c128b141c2d49cbf9
1 Input
1 Output
-
3e63caab1943a32747f9701ba5281f707658c693bf0e9b6c128b141c2d49cbf9:0
- value
- 179094
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fc1cd9f20cb91a2620f114f542862dfdad6020bc21b0c1e300800005b188362a
- address
- bc1plswdnusvhydzvg83zn659p3dlkkkqg9uyxcvrccqsqqqtvvgxc4q75sgga